Transaction 83e863dc2138d790fadfa1fe5c8a2469ff95ee786a3750861d74829ac2e99081
2 Input
2 Outputs
- 83e863dc2138d790fadfa1fe5c8a2469ff95ee786a3750861d74829ac2e99081:0
- 83e863dc2138d790fadfa1fe5c8a2469ff95ee786a3750861d74829ac2e99081:1
value 3224236
address 1G1tDSK2PT4VHBSnkPMydABnsRW5uJNdeV
value 19503537
address 1H8ceEdJiLBRP2vtrEnC8vAkXEq8fyT1m7